Argentina Says It Bought Back $270 Million in Bonds This Week
Bloomberg
August 15, 2008

By Eliana Raszewski and Drew Benson

Argentina bought back $270 million in bonds this week as part of a program it announced on Aug. 10, the Economy Ministry said in an e-mail statement.

``The government will continue with this buyback program in coming days,'' the ministry said in the statement tonight.
